Understanding Eco-Friendly Car Removal
Eco-friendly car removal is a process designed to reduce the environmental impact of disposing of old or damaged vehicles. Instead of sending cars directly to landfills, recycling and reuse take priority. Each vehicle is carefully dismantled, and its parts are sorted into categories such as metals, plastics, glass, and rubber. Usable components are resold or reused, while harmful materials like engine fluids and batteries are removed and treated safely.

Why Traditional Car Disposal Causes Environmental Harm
Older methods of car disposal often involved abandoning vehicles in landfills or leaving them in open spaces to rust. These cars release toxic substances, including oil, brake fluid, and coolant, that seep into the soil and contaminate water systems. Over time, the metal from the vehicle corrodes, releasing harmful particles into the air and ground.
This pollution not only damages the environment but also affects local wildlife. Animals can ingest small metal fragments or drink contaminated water, leading to health complications. In contrast, eco-friendly car removal ensures that all hazardous substances are handled according to environmental regulations, preventing such contamination.
Steps Involved in Eco-Friendly Car Removal
Vehicle Inspection
The process starts with a detailed assessment of the car. Experts check its condition, identify parts that can be reused, and list materials suitable for recycling.
Fluid and Battery Removal
All fluids, including fuel, oil, coolant, and brake fluid, are drained and stored in approved containers. Car batteries, which contain lead and acid, are also removed for proper recycling.
Parts Recovery and Reuse
Usable car parts such as engines, transmissions, alternators, and tyres are separated and resold for reuse. This reduces the need for new parts manufacturing, saving energy and natural resources.
Metal Recycling
The remaining metal body is crushed and sent to recycling facilities where it is melted and transformed into raw material for new products. Recycling steel and aluminium from vehicles reduces the carbon footprint of producing new metal.
Safe Disposal of Non-Recyclable Materials
Any remaining waste that cannot be reused or recycled is disposed of safely in accordance with environmental guidelines to avoid pollution.

Government Regulations Supporting Green Car Disposal
The Australian government has implemented various environmental policies to ensure the responsible handling of scrap vehicles. Car recycling facilities in Sydney must follow the National Waste Policy and environmental protection laws that regulate the treatment of hazardous materials.
Authorities also encourage the public to participate in recycling programs by offering incentives and awareness campaigns. These initiatives aim to reduce landfill waste and move towards a circular economy, where materials are reused and repurposed instead of discarded.
How Car Recycling Conserves Natural Resources
Recycling metals such as steel, aluminium, and copper from old vehicles reduces the need for new mining activities. Extracting and processing raw materials consumes large amounts of energy and produces greenhouse gas emissions. When car parts are recycled, energy use decreases significantly, helping reduce overall carbon emissions.
In addition, reusing car components like tires, mirrors, and engines reduces the demand for new manufacturing, which also cuts down on pollution. This makes eco-friendly car removal not just a disposal solution but a step towards sustainable living.
